Basic State PensionEveryone eligible for the basic State Pension has now reached State Pension age . You will have already claimed your basic State Pension unless you delayed (deferred) your State Pension . You will not qualify for the Additional State Pension, but you might still be able to inherit Additional State Pension from your partner. The Additional State Pension is paid with your basic State Pension.
